Opel to axe 2,000 jobs
Opel labor says more jobs to go after meeting CEO
Posted on Monday, February 1st, 2010 at 2:30 PM EST.(Employee News)
General Motors Co. is planning to axe 2,000 additional jobs at its Opel arm, but has changed its mind on management cost cuts, European labor leaders said after a face-to-face with Opel’s boss on Monday, Reuters reported.
It was the first face-to-face meeting between the two sides since GM angered labor last month with the announcement that Opel’s Antwerp plant would close, a move one union leader called a “declaration of war,” the news service said. “According to the plans, headcount will be cut by 2,000 additional persons in comparison to management statements in public,” Opel’s European works council said in a statement after meeting with Opel Chief Executive Nick O’Reilly.
An Opel spokesman said the company was sticking to the 8,300 job cuts it had announced as part of plans to reduce capacity by a fifth to counter feeble demand that could stay weak for years, the report said. GM has said that 4,000 of those cuts would be in Germany, the story said. (Reuters)
